CVE-2017-17417 is a critical SQL injection vulnerability affecting Quest NetVault Backup 11.3.0.12, allowing un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ary code. This flaw stems from insufficient validation of user-supplied input used in SQL queries within the NVBUPhaseStatus Acknowledge method. With a CVSS score of 9.8, it presents a severe risk, enabling full compromise of the underlying database and system. While not listed in CISA's KEV catalog, public exploit code exists on ExploitDB, indicating a clear path for exploitation.
